Ejemplo n.º 1
0
        public static void InsertPersonne(Personne p)
        {
            //recup de la chaine de connexion
            var connectString = Properties.Settings.Default.ConnectString;
            //écriture requete
            string queryString = @"insert into Employees(LastName,FirstName) values(@Nom,@Prenom)";
            //parametres de la requete
            var paramNom = new SqlParameter("@Nom", DbType.String);

            paramNom.Value = p.Nom;
            var paramPrenom = new SqlParameter("@Prenom", DbType.String);

            paramPrenom.Value = p.Prenom;
            //création de la connexion à partir de la chaine de connexion
            using (var connect = new SqlConnection(connectString))
            {
                var command = new SqlCommand(queryString, connect);
                command.Parameters.Add(paramNom);
                command.Parameters.Add(paramPrenom);

                connect.Open();
                command.ExecuteNonQuery();
            }
        }
Ejemplo n.º 2
0
 public ContexteEmploye()
 {
     Employes       = new ObservableCollection <Personne>(DAL.GetPersonnes());
     EmployeCourant = new Personne();
 }